Bib Gourmand and Estrella Gastropub Top 50 restaurant with a vibrant atmosphere offering Modern Middle Eastern cuisine in Glastonbury. We are looking for a Sous Chef to join our kitchen team to support our head chef, and help to oversee the smooth running of prep and service.

This role can grow into a head chef position for the right candidate.

Responsibilities include:

  • Training the team
  • Running service

How to prepare for a job interview at Queen of Cups

Know Your Cuisine

Familiarise yourself with Modern Middle Eastern cuisine before the interview. Be ready to discuss your favourite dishes, cooking techniques, and how you can bring your own flair to the menu. This shows your passion and understanding of the restaurant's style.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Sous Chef, you'll be supporting the head chef and training the team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a kitchen team in the past, handled conflicts, or improved service efficiency. This will demonstrate your readiness for the role.

Discuss Your Experience with Prep and Service

Be prepared to talk about your experience in both food prep and service. Highlight any specific techniques or systems you've implemented that improved workflow. This will show that you understand the importance of a smooth-running kitchen.

Express Your Career Aspirations

Since this role can grow into a head chef position, share your career goals and how you see yourself evolving within the company. This shows ambition and commitment, which are key traits for a successful Sous Chef.
